Market Context

In recent weeks, DX has seen largely normal trading volume, with occasional above-average volume spikes coinciding with major public communications from central bank officials that shifted interest rate expectations. The broader mortgage REIT sector has delivered mixed performance this month, as market participants weigh competing signals about the trajectory of short-term interest rates and mortgage credit spreads. Income-focused investors have also been adjusting their allocations to high-dividend asset classes amid evolving market expectations for inflation and monetary policy, which has contributed to uneven trading patterns across the mREIT space. Unlike many equities that are reacting to recent earnings releases, DX’s price moves have been closely correlated with shifts in the 10-year Treasury yield, a common benchmark for mortgage-related assets, in recent sessions. Technical Analysis

From a technical standpoint, DX has two clear near-term price levels that market participants are watching closely. Immediate support is identified at $12.59, a level that has acted as a reliable floor during three separate pullbacks this month, with buying interest typically picking up as the stock approaches this price point. On the upside, immediate resistance sits at $13.91, a level that has halted upward moves on multiple occasions in recent weeks, as selling pressure has increased each time DX nears that threshold. The stock’s relative strength index (RSI) is currently in the mid-50s, indicating neutral momentum with no extreme overbought or oversold signals that would suggest an imminent sharp reversal. DX is also trading above its short-term moving average range, which may signal mild short-term upward momentum, while it remains below its longer-term moving average cohort, pointing to potential lingering headwinds for sustained longer-term gains. Outlook

Looking ahead to upcoming trading sessions, there are two key scenarios that market participants are monitoring for DX. If the stock were to test and break above the $13.91 resistance level on above-average volume, that could potentially signal a shift in near-term momentum to the upside, with traders likely watching for follow-through buying interest after a breakout. Conversely, if DX pulls back and breaks below the $12.59 support level on elevated volume, that could possibly lead to further near-term downside pressure, as that would mark a break of a previously reliable support floor. Given the lack of confirmed upcoming company-specific catalysts as of this analysis, DX’s price action will likely remain closely tied to broader macroeconomic trends, including shifts in interest rate expectations, changes in mortgage spread dynamics, and overall investor demand for high-dividend alternative assets. Market participants may also want to monitor volume levels during any test of the identified support and resistance levels, as volume can be a useful indicator of the strength of any potential breakout or breakdown.
